taylorcocks sets up new Southampton office headed by new equity partner
One of the region’s top rated accountancy firms and business advisers, taylorcocks, has grown its offering in the South by expanding its operations in the Southampton area.
The new office, at International House, Southampton International Business Park, will be headed up by the recently appointed Julian Sheppard, who joins the firm as an equity partner.
The ambitious firm, which secured over 200 new clients in 2009, is enjoying one of its most successful periods of growth since it was established in 1996 and has further expanded as a result of increased demand for its services in the Southampton area. Taylorcocks now has seven offices in locations across Southampton, Portsmouth, London, Oxford, Reading, Farnham and Bournemouth, and employs more than 100 people.

Julian has an entrepreneurial background himself having started his own accountancy and business advisory practice in 1987 before selling to Grant Thornton in 2001. He has also been finance director and shareholder in three other businesses - one floated on AIM, one sold to a public company in 2007 and his own sales and engineering business sold in 1997 to an American group.
